After years of responding to Cape Elizabeth properties, a handful of causes show up again and again. Here's what to watch for.
Aging plumbing, sudden temperature swings, and worn supply lines are among the most common reasons Cape Elizabeth residents call us. A single burst pipe can release hundreds of gallons before it's noticed, especially overnight.
Storm damage often shows up first as a small ceiling stain in Cape Elizabeth properties, but by the time it's visible, water has usually already reached the insulation and framing underneath.
Clogged municipal lines, tree root intrusion, and sump pump failures can send contaminated water back into Cape Elizabeth basements and lower levels, requiring specialized cleanup and sanitizing.
Water heaters, washing machines, dishwashers, and HVAC condensation lines are common — and often overlooked — sources of slow leaks that eventually cause significant damage in Cape Elizabeth properties if left unnoticed.
Poor drainage patterns are a frequent contributor to recurring water issues in Cape Elizabeth basements, especially in older neighborhoods with mature landscaping and settled soil.
Water used to extinguish a fire, or an accidental sprinkler discharge, can leave a Cape Elizabeth property with significant secondary water damage that needs immediate attention right after the fire crew leaves.

Plenty of Cape Elizabeth homeowners try to handle a small water event themselves before calling us. Here's what usually gets missed.
The visible water on your Cape Elizabeth floor is often only part of the problem. Water wicks upward into drywall, travels along subfloor seams, and pools inside wall cavities where a rented fan will never reach it. Without professional-grade dehumidification and moisture monitoring, that hidden dampness can sit for weeks, quietly feeding mold growth long after the surface looks and feels dry to the touch.
There's also the insurance side to consider. Without professional documentation — moisture readings, photos, a written scope of work — it can be much harder to support a claim if secondary damage shows up later. Our Cape Elizabeth technicians build that documentation as part of every job, protecting you if issues surface down the road.
None of this means every spill needs a professional crew — a small, contained, surface-level spill that's dried within a few hours is usually fine to handle yourself. But once water has soaked into flooring, baseboards, or drywall, or if it's been sitting for more than a few hours, it's worth a call to make sure nothing's hiding beneath the surface.
Every water loss is different, but these general safety steps apply to most Cape Elizabeth calls we receive.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
Never touch electrical switches, outlets, or appliances that are wet or near standing water — the risk of shock is real.
If it's safe, move furniture, electronics, and important documents away from the affected area or up off the floor.
Snap photos or video of the affected areas before anything is moved — this helps your insurance claim later.
Some airflow can help, but don't rely on it alone — professional drying equipment is still necessary to prevent mold.
